WebPrivate subnets Three IP network address ranges are reserved for private networks. The addresses are 10.0.0.0/8, 172.16.0.0/12, and 192.168.0.0/16. These addresses can be used by anyone setting up …
WebAvoid the high range as well. 192.168.255.0/24 etc. Some networking gear has issues routing or recognizing those IPs due to an obsolete RFC. Use .254 as your highest range. 192.168.168.0/24 is used by Sonicwalls as the default.
